Raise Your Floral Experience with Flower Station Dubai at Our Flower Store
Enhance Your Occasion With Stunning Flower Program From Specialist ServicesBoosting the atmosphere of an occasion with elegant flower arrangements is a classic art form that can change any kind of space right into a captivating haven of appeal and style. Specialist blossom setup solutions offer a degree of expertise and creative thinking that can r